A Bank Robber Attempted to Impersonate Paul Simon

A con man walks into a branch of Citibank on Broadway and West 86th Street in Manhattan and tried to take out $4,300 using Paul Simon’s name and bank account number. Sounds like the beginning of a joke, but nope, this is real. His name is Rafael Ramos, and he’s 54 years old. From the Post:

“The teller became suspicious after realizing the suspect is 10 inches taller and 14 years younger than the 5-foot-3, 68-year-old Simon. When she refused to give him the money, Ramos bolted, according to authorities.”

Apparently, Ramos was carrying a forged driver’s license and credit card with Simon’s name on them. He was to be charged for larceny, however, he told the cops he was depressed so they took him to the hospital instead.
